What is SUPER INDEX?
SUPER INDEX allows you to quickly search for a program or a scene you want to view or the point from
which you want to start recording on tape, with the following four functions:
INDEX SEARCH:
You can locate the beginning of a recorded program, using the INDEX
feature*.
* Each time you press the REC button to start recording, the
VCR will record an INDEX mark at the start of recording. The INDEX
feature uses this signal recorded on tapes (VISS signal) to locate the
beginning of a program you want to view.
BLANK SEARCH: You can locate the beginning of a blank (non-recorded) section on tape.
EASY VIEW: This switches fast forward or rewind to visual search so that you can search
for a scene you want to view while scanning the pictures
SKIP PLAY: You can skip unnecessary scenes during play.
Locating the beginning of a recorded program (INDEX SEARCH)
NOTE: This function only works with recordings that have been set up with indexing.
1 Press the
button (rewind) or the button (forward) to begin the index search in the
STOP mode.
The INDEX search screen is displayed, and the tape rewinds or fast forwards until an index mark is
detected.
A black square in the tape bar shows the current tape position.
When the VCR finds an index mark, it plays 15 seconds of the program that begins at that spot.
NOTE: Tape bar will not appear correctly if the tapes which have scratches or are slack are being used.
2 If this is the program you were looking for press the PLAY button for normal playback.
To stop the index search before an index mark is reached, press the STOP button.
Note: If there are no index marks on the tape, the VCR will just rewind to the beginning or fast forward to
the end.
